Summary: In late 18th century Italy, a beautiful young woman finds herself married to a rich but cruel older man... (imdb)
Country: USA
Directed By: Mervyn LeRoy

Man, the stuff I watch at 3 in the morning on TCM. I basically tuned in because I recognized Claude Rains' voice and fortunately he was the best part of the movie. Anyway, this was OKAY, but overlong, melodramatic, and cliched. I didn't even realize Angela was Olivia de Havilland until the credits, and I'm thoroughly amused that Gale Sondergaard got the first ever Supporting Actress Oscar for smirking and sneering the entire movie.
